Painting Description
"Allegorie De La Comedie" is a notable work by the Hungarian painter Mihály von Zichy, who is renowned for his contributions to Romanticism and his intricate, expressive style. Created during the 19th century, this painting exemplifies Zichy's ability to blend allegorical themes with a keen sense of drama and emotion. Zichy, who was born in 1827 and passed away in 1906, spent a significant portion of his career in Russia, where he served as a court painter. His works often reflect a deep engagement with literary and theatrical subjects, and "Allegorie De La Comedie" is no exception.
The painting is an allegorical representation of comedy, a theme that Zichy approached with both reverence and a touch of whimsy. The composition is characterized by its dynamic arrangement and the vivid portrayal of figures, which are hallmarks of Zichy's style. The central figure, presumably representing Comedy itself, is depicted with a lively expression and theatrical gestures, embodying the spirit of the genre. Surrounding this figure are various elements that symbolize different aspects of comedic art, including masks, musical instruments, and playful characters, all meticulously detailed to enhance the narrative quality of the piece.
Zichy's use of light and shadow in "Allegorie De La Comedie" adds depth and a sense of movement, drawing the viewer's eye across the canvas and inviting them to explore the intricate details. The painting not only showcases Zichy's technical prowess but also his ability to convey complex themes through visual storytelling. As with many of his works, "Allegorie De La Comedie" reflects Zichy's fascination with the human condition and his talent for capturing the essence of his subjects with both sensitivity and grandeur.
This piece is a testament to Mihály von Zichy's enduring legacy in the art world, illustrating his unique ability to blend allegory with a vivid, almost theatrical presentation. It remains a significant work for those studying Romantic art and the evolution of allegorical painting in the 19th century.
